Nico Rosberg thinks Mercedes could threaten Red Bull Racing in the 2024 Formula 1 season. The 2016 F1 champion thinks his former employers are finally starting to understand the problems with the W14 car and that the limited wind tunnel time will also affect Red Bull.

While Rosberg is upfront that Red Bull and Verstappen are at an advantage after the dominant 2023 season, he points out that limited development time in the wind tunnel could hurt the team. This would allow teams like Ferrari, McLaren and Mercedes to catch up.

Asked by Daily Mail about the chances of Toto Wolff's team to have a shot at the world title next year, Rosberg replied, "We've seen flashes of brilliance from the Mercedes team just recently. They lack consistency. But look at Austin. They were challenging for the win there and actually had the fastest car over the weekend."

Rosberg: 'Mercedes are starting to understand the car'

He continued: "So we've seen that they're starting to understand the car, and they just have the problem that you still lack consistency. They still lack in straight line performance, but they are starting to understand all that. I believe in Mercedes ability because I was there. I know how strong they are. It's always still the same people. So certainly there is a chance that Hamilton could once again fight for the championship next year."

Asked if he would be happy if Hamilton won an eighth world title, Rosberg replied: "I would be happy if Mercedes won, because that's kind of my racing family from the past. But then Lewis, I'm neutral there. I just would like a great fight for the championship, and may the best driver win. But I'm not biased in that sense, obviously.\'
